java中tostring方法怎么用

互联网 20-6-16

在JAVA中,所有的对象都有toString方法;

创建类时没有定义toString方法,输出对象时,会输出对象的哈希值;

它只是sun公司开发java的时候为了方便所有类的字符串操作而特意加入的一个方法

它通常只是为了方便输出:

例如:

public class Test2{     String name;       int age;      public String toString(){             return "我的姓名是:"+name+"\t我的年龄是:"+age;       }     public static void main(String[] args){     Test2 Myclass =new Test2();         Myclass.name = "小明";         Myclass.age = 20;         System.out.println(Myclass);       //直接使用对象名时默认调用该对象的toString方法      System.out.println(Myclass.toString());//手动调用String方法    }

运行结果:

如果类中没有定义toString方法,按照以上案例调用时,会输出对象的哈希值,如下案例所示:

运行结果:

推荐教程: 《java教程》

以上就是java中tostring方法怎么用的详细内容,更多内容请关注技术你好其它相关文章!

来源链接:
免责声明:
1.资讯内容不构成投资建议,投资者应独立决策并自行承担风险
2.本文版权归属原作所有,仅代表作者本人观点,不代表本站的观点或立场
标签: java
上一篇:php获取远程图片并下载保存到本地的方法分析 下一篇:swoole协程怎么开启

相关资讯